From a 750ml crawler. No date on it, but my friend picked it up Memorial Day weekend.
This beer is a nice looking dark amber color and is somewhat murky looking. There's a thick 2 finger slightly off white head. Frothy looking and has decent retention. There's a bit of lacing on the glass.
The nose is not very strong, and I left it out of the fridge a good half hour for it to warm up a bit. I get a very faint pine aroma, but it is super faint.
Taste - Well, sadly, the taste is a lot like the nose: faint. First off, what I'm getting doesn't taste bad at all. I get a very faint pine flavor. There's a slight roasted malt flavor. There is a bit of a build of bitterness on the back, but, again, faint.
Yeah, there's a bit of bubbly feeling. There's a bit of bitterness on the back. Body is decent.
This beer is a let down. What I got wasn't bad, but I got so damn little off it. Kinda sad.
